A 30-year-old Kenosha bartender named Karly J. Ashmus was charged yesterday with seven counts of Possession of Child Pornography. The Kenosha woman, who bartends at Lucci’s and Final Inning, made her first appearance in court yesterday.

Each count carries with it a minimum prison sentence of three years and a maximum sentence of 25 years. She faces up to 175 years behind bars. Although the mandatory minimum is three years, most Kenosha judges run multiple sentences concurrently, so the minimum is three years prison, regardless of how many convictions.

In court yesterday, Kenosha County Assistant District Attorney Dreh Lehman made the following statement:

“The court set a temporary bond of $75,000 on Friday. I believe that that should continue as cash bond in this case with conditions to include no use or possession of internet-capable devices, no contact with any person under the age of 18…”

Criminal defense attorney Frank Parise asked for a bail not to exceed $10,000, citing among other things, Ashmus’s ties to the community and her being a life-long Kenosha resident.

Kenosha County Circuit Court Commissioner Donald Bielski lowered Ashmus’s bail by $60,000. Bail is now $15,000 cash.

According to the criminal complaint:

On August 16th 2024 a Kenosha Police detective was assigned a tip as part of her involvement with the Wisconsin Department of Justice, Division of Criminal Investigations (DCI), Internet Crimes Against Children (ICAC) Task Force. The source of the tip was Amazon. 

Upon reviewing other data provided by the informant, the Kenosha Police detective noted that the account owner where the photos were stored was Karly Ashmus, and that Ashmus had been a customer of the photo sharing platform since October 22, 2016.

Multiple photos of Ashmus’ driver’s license, social security card, and check stubs were located within the files. On November 26, 2024 a search warrant was executed at Ashmus’ residence. She was advised that there was a tip that was linked to her residence. Ashmus denied knowing of any reason why the Kenosha Police Department Internet Crime Against Children Task Force unit would have received the tip. She was asked if there would be any concerning materials on her phone and she stated “no, not that I can think of.”

An Officer asked her if she would be willing to speak with her about the investigation and she agreed to speak with police. 

Ashmus confirm that she lived the residence with her ex-boyfriend in a duplex and another male lives in the lower half. While asking Ashmus for specific details regarding who all lives in the residence, the defendant asked the officer, “so, what was it, pictures or something,” referring to the cyber tip that police received. Before the officer could answer her, Ashmus said “sorry, I am just really concerned right now.” 

Ashmus was asked if she views any type of pornography and she stated that she does. She stated that she uses a website to watch “girl on girl porn.” Police later found more child pornography including a video on Ashmus’ phone.

Police confronted her with some of the images and Ashmus denied knowing where they came from but guessed that the girl in the photos appear to be 8 years old.

Ashmus is due in court again on December 17, 2024, for a preliminary hearing.
